The Chicago pastors’ and elders’ wives initiated an invitation for the seeJesus ministry to come and teach “A Praying Life” seminar on May 16-17, 2025, at our Chicago church. Pastor Will Peycke led the seminar. We didn’t just learn about having childlike faith to pray, but more importantly, we spent time praying and then shared with the 100 other attendants what was hard, awkward, and good about those prayer experiences. People found the seminar to be gracious and encouraging, as we learned that prayer is easier than we think when we can lay down our expectations and realize that Father God wants us to be honest and helpless in our prayers.

We were introduced to the tool of prayer cards as a practical method for praying faithfully for ourselves, our anxieties, difficult relationships, work, and other people. It was wonderful to see preteens, teens, college students, and adults attend. It was also encouraging that teens and young adults volunteered as greeters, book table sellers, babysitters, and photographers.

We pray that this seminar may bear lasting fruit as we keep praying and also do ten-week cohorts on the material, “A Praying Life” and “A Praying Church,” both written by Paul Miller.
